Most worthwhile careers require some kind of specialized training. Ideally, therefore, the choice of a(n)【C1】______should be made even before the choice of a curriculum in high school. Actually,【C2】______, most people make several job choices during their working lives,【C3】______because of economic and industrial changes and partly to【C4】______their positions.
The "one perfect job" does not exist. Young people should【C5】______ enter into a broad flexible training program that will【C6】______them for a field of work rather than for a single【C7】______. Unfortunately many young people have to make career plans【C8】______ benefit of help from a competent vocational counselor or psychologist. Knowing【C9】______ about the occupational world, or themselves for that matter, they choose their lifework on a hit-or-miss【C10】______. Some drift from job to job. Others【C11】______to work in which they are unhappy and for which they are not fitted.
One common mistake is choosing an occupation for【C12】______real or imagined prestige. Too many high school students—or their parents—choose the professional field,【C13】______both the relatively small proportion of workers in the professions and the extremely high educational and personal【C14】______. The real or imagined prestige of a profession or a "white-collar" job is【C15】______ good reason for choosing it as life’s work.【C16】______, these occupations are not always well paid. Since a large proportion of jobs are in mechanical and manual work, the【C17】______of young people should give serious【C18】______to these fields.
Before making an occupational choice, a person should have a【C19】______idea of what he wants out of life and how hard he is willing to work to get it. Some people desire social prestige, others intellectual satisfaction. Some want security: others are willing to take【C20】______ for financial gains. Each occupational choice has its demands as well as its rewards.
【C5】
选项
A、furthermore
B、therefore
C、consequently
D、moreover
答案
B
解析
语篇衔接题。句意为:因此年轻人应该参与更加灵活的培训项目……。上文提到“完美的工作并不存在”,而本句提到“年轻人应该参与更加灵活的培训项目”,显然,本句与上文之间是因果关系,且本句的“果”是由作者推导而来的,并不是实际情况。[B]therefore“因此,所以”,引导推论中的“果”,因此该项正确。[A]furthermore“此外”表示递进关系,与原文不符,故排除;[C]consequently“因此,结果是”,一般侧重于真实情况的结果,故排除;[D]moreover“而且,此外”表递进,不符合本题要求,故排除。
